Cost may be adjusted to reflect changes in the general level <br />of prices in the construction industry between the date of <br />submission of the Construction Documents to the Owner and <br />the date on which proposals are sought. <br /> <br />5.2.4 If a fixed limit of Construction Cost is exceeded by <br />the lowest bona fide bid or negotiated proposal, the Owner <br />shall: <br /> <br /> .1 give written approval of an increase in such fixed <br /> limit; <br /> <br /> .2 authorize rebidding or renegotiating of the Project <br /> within a reasonable time; <br /> <br /> .3 if the Project is abandoned, terminate in accordance <br /> with Paragraph 8.3; or <br /> <br /> .4 cooperate in revising the Project scope and quality <br /> as required to reduce the Construction Cost. <br /> <br />5.2.5 If the Owner chooses to proceed under Clause <br />5.2.4.4, the Architect, without additional charge, shall <br />modify the Contract Documents as necessary to comply with <br />the fixed limit, if established as a condition of this <br />Agreement. The modification of Contract Documents shall <br />be the limit of the Architect's responsibility arising out of the <br />eslablistunent cfa fixed limit. The Architect shall be entitled <br />to compensation in accordance with this Agreement for all <br />services performed whether or not the Construction Phase is <br />commenced, <br /> <br /> ARTICLE 6 <br /> USE OF ARCHITECT'S DRAWINGS, <br /> SPECIFICATIONS AND OTHER DOCUMENTS <br /> <br />6.t The Drawings, Specifications and other documents <br />prepared by the Architect for this Project are instruments of <br />the Architect's service for use solely with respect to this <br />Project, and the Architect shall be deemed the author of these <br />documents and shall retain all common law, statutory and <br />other reserved rights, including the copyright. The Owner <br />shall be permitted to retain copies, including reproducible <br />copies, of the Architect's Drawings, Specifications and other <br />documents for information and reference in connection with <br />the Owner's use and occupancy of the Project.
